O'Reilly & Averbuch Named Honda Soccer Award Finalists
December 6, 2006 | Women's Soccer
Dec. 6, 2006
CHAPEL HILL, N.C. - Senior forward Heather O'Reilly and sophomore midfielder Yael Averbuch are among the four nominees in women's soccer for the 2006-2007 Honda Sports Award to determine the top woman collegiate athlete in that sport. The winner after nationwide balloting will become a nominee for The Honda-Broderick Cup awarded annually to the Collegiate Woman Athlete of the Year. In addition to the honor of this selection, American Honda Motor Co. Inc will donate $1,000 to the women's athletic fund of each nominee's university. The winner's program will receive $5,000.
The ballot will be emailed to all NCAA senior women administrators by Monday, December 11 with results of the balloting late Friday December 15.

CAREER HIGHLIGHTS
Heather O'Reilly, Senior Forward, University of North Carolina
*Senior captain of 2006 NCAA championship team
*Member of U.S. National Team since 2002
*2004 Olympic Gold Medalist
*2006 ESPN The Magazine Academic All-America of the Year
*2006 ESPN The Magazine first-team Academic All-America, 2005 ESPN The Magazine second-team Academic All-America
*Most Outstanding Offensive Player of 2003 and 2006 NCAA College Cup
*Member of 2003 & 2006 NCAA championship team and 2003, 2005, 2006 ACC championship team
*15 NCAA Tournament goals, third most in NCAA history, topped only by Christine Sinclair and Lindsay Tarpley
*44 NCAA Tournament points, third most in NCAA history, topped only by Christine Sinclair and Lindsay Tarpley
*2004 U.S. Soccer Young Female Athlete of the Year
*2004 and 2006 M.A.C. Hermann Trophy finalist
*2004, 2005, 2006 Honda Award finalist
*2004, 2005, 2006 Soccer Buzz Player of the Year finalist
*2004, 2005, 2006 UNC leading scorer
*2004, 2005, 2006 consensus first-team All-America selection
*2004, 2005, 2006 first-team All-ACC
*2003, 2004, 2005, 2006 All-ACC Tournament
*2003 consensus National Freshman of the Year
*2005 ACC Offensive Player of the Year
*Scored game-winning goal in 2004 Olympic semifinals
*2002 gold medalist at U19 World Championships (4 goals, 7 assists in tournament)
*59 career goals (10 at UNC), 49 career assists (12th at UNC), 167 career points (11th at UNC)
*Active in community service (Carolina Dreams, Get Kids in Action, Adopt a Classroom, Katrina Relief Fund, Carolina Outreach, Share Your Holiday)
Yael Averbuch, Sophomore Midfielder, University of North Carolina
*2006 ACC Offensive Player of the Year
*2006 first-team All-ACC
*16 goals, 7 assists, 39 points in 2006
*2006 first-team NSCAA & Top Drawer Soccer All-America
*Scored fastest goal in NCAA history at start of game (4 seconds versus Yale 9/3/2006)
*2006 Top Drawer Soccer Player of the Season
*2006 M.A.C. Hermann Trophy Finalist
*2006 All-ACC Tournament and All-Tournament at NCAA College Cup
*Member of U.S. Under 20 National Team
*2005 Soccer Buzz and Soccer America freshman All-America
